533714c714f60de7a0c6d384264a1a82.json 4.49 KB
{"ast":null,"code":"import _extends from \"@babel/runtime/helpers/extends\";\nimport _defineProperty from \"@babel/runtime/helpers/defineProperty\";\nimport * as React from 'react';\nimport classNames from 'classnames';\n\nvar Element = function Element(props) {\n  var _classNames, _classNames2;\n\n  var prefixCls = props.prefixCls,\n      className = props.className,\n      style = props.style,\n      size = props.size,\n      shape = props.shape;\n  var sizeCls = classNames((_classNames = {}, _defineProperty(_classNames, \"\".concat(prefixCls, \"-lg\"), size === 'large'), _defineProperty(_classNames, \"\".concat(prefixCls, \"-sm\"), size === 'small'), _classNames));\n  var shapeCls = classNames((_classNames2 = {}, _defineProperty(_classNames2, \"\".concat(prefixCls, \"-circle\"), shape === 'circle'), _defineProperty(_classNames2, \"\".concat(prefixCls, \"-square\"), shape === 'square'), _defineProperty(_classNames2, \"\".concat(prefixCls, \"-round\"), shape === 'round'), _classNames2));\n  var sizeStyle = typeof size === 'number' ? {\n    width: size,\n    height: size,\n    lineHeight: \"\".concat(size, \"px\")\n  } : {};\n  return /*#__PURE__*/React.createElement(\"span\", {\n    className: classNames(prefixCls, sizeCls, shapeCls, className),\n    style: _extends(_extends({}, sizeStyle), style)\n  });\n};\n\nexport default Element;","map":{"version":3,"sources":["C:/Users/kkwan_000/Desktop/git/2017110269/minsung/node_modules/antd/es/skeleton/Element.js"],"names":["_extends","_defineProperty","React","classNames","Element","props","_classNames","_classNames2","prefixCls","className","style","size","shape","sizeCls","concat","shapeCls","sizeStyle","width","height","lineHeight","createElement"],"mappings":"AAAA,OAAOA,QAAP,MAAqB,gCAArB;AACA,OAAOC,eAAP,MAA4B,uCAA5B;AACA,OAAO,KAAKC,KAAZ,MAAuB,OAAvB;AACA,OAAOC,UAAP,MAAuB,YAAvB;;AAEA,IAAIC,OAAO,GAAG,SAASA,OAAT,CAAiBC,KAAjB,EAAwB;AACpC,MAAIC,WAAJ,EAAiBC,YAAjB;;AAEA,MAAIC,SAAS,GAAGH,KAAK,CAACG,SAAtB;AAAA,MACIC,SAAS,GAAGJ,KAAK,CAACI,SADtB;AAAA,MAEIC,KAAK,GAAGL,KAAK,CAACK,KAFlB;AAAA,MAGIC,IAAI,GAAGN,KAAK,CAACM,IAHjB;AAAA,MAIIC,KAAK,GAAGP,KAAK,CAACO,KAJlB;AAKA,MAAIC,OAAO,GAAGV,UAAU,EAAEG,WAAW,GAAG,EAAd,EAAkBL,eAAe,CAACK,WAAD,EAAc,GAAGQ,MAAH,CAAUN,SAAV,EAAqB,KAArB,CAAd,EAA2CG,IAAI,KAAK,OAApD,CAAjC,EAA+FV,eAAe,CAACK,WAAD,EAAc,GAAGQ,MAAH,CAAUN,SAAV,EAAqB,KAArB,CAAd,EAA2CG,IAAI,KAAK,OAApD,CAA9G,EAA4KL,WAA9K,EAAxB;AACA,MAAIS,QAAQ,GAAGZ,UAAU,EAAEI,YAAY,GAAG,EAAf,EAAmBN,eAAe,CAACM,YAAD,EAAe,GAAGO,MAAH,CAAUN,SAAV,EAAqB,SAArB,CAAf,EAAgDI,KAAK,KAAK,QAA1D,CAAlC,EAAuGX,eAAe,CAACM,YAAD,EAAe,GAAGO,MAAH,CAAUN,SAAV,EAAqB,SAArB,CAAf,EAAgDI,KAAK,KAAK,QAA1D,CAAtH,EAA2LX,eAAe,CAACM,YAAD,EAAe,GAAGO,MAAH,CAAUN,SAAV,EAAqB,QAArB,CAAf,EAA+CI,KAAK,KAAK,OAAzD,CAA1M,EAA6QL,YAA/Q,EAAzB;AACA,MAAIS,SAAS,GAAG,OAAOL,IAAP,KAAgB,QAAhB,GAA2B;AACzCM,IAAAA,KAAK,EAAEN,IADkC;AAEzCO,IAAAA,MAAM,EAAEP,IAFiC;AAGzCQ,IAAAA,UAAU,EAAE,GAAGL,MAAH,CAAUH,IAAV,EAAgB,IAAhB;AAH6B,GAA3B,GAIZ,EAJJ;AAKA,SAAO,aAAaT,KAAK,CAACkB,aAAN,CAAoB,MAApB,EAA4B;AAC9CX,IAAAA,SAAS,EAAEN,UAAU,CAACK,SAAD,EAAYK,OAAZ,EAAqBE,QAArB,EAA+BN,SAA/B,CADyB;AAE9CC,IAAAA,KAAK,EAAEV,QAAQ,CAACA,QAAQ,CAAC,EAAD,EAAKgB,SAAL,CAAT,EAA0BN,KAA1B;AAF+B,GAA5B,CAApB;AAID,CAnBD;;AAqBA,eAAeN,OAAf","sourcesContent":["import _extends from \"@babel/runtime/helpers/extends\";\nimport _defineProperty from \"@babel/runtime/helpers/defineProperty\";\nimport * as React from 'react';\nimport classNames from 'classnames';\n\nvar Element = function Element(props) {\n  var _classNames, _classNames2;\n\n  var prefixCls = props.prefixCls,\n      className = props.className,\n      style = props.style,\n      size = props.size,\n      shape = props.shape;\n  var sizeCls = classNames((_classNames = {}, _defineProperty(_classNames, \"\".concat(prefixCls, \"-lg\"), size === 'large'), _defineProperty(_classNames, \"\".concat(prefixCls, \"-sm\"), size === 'small'), _classNames));\n  var shapeCls = classNames((_classNames2 = {}, _defineProperty(_classNames2, \"\".concat(prefixCls, \"-circle\"), shape === 'circle'), _defineProperty(_classNames2, \"\".concat(prefixCls, \"-square\"), shape === 'square'), _defineProperty(_classNames2, \"\".concat(prefixCls, \"-round\"), shape === 'round'), _classNames2));\n  var sizeStyle = typeof size === 'number' ? {\n    width: size,\n    height: size,\n    lineHeight: \"\".concat(size, \"px\")\n  } : {};\n  return /*#__PURE__*/React.createElement(\"span\", {\n    className: classNames(prefixCls, sizeCls, shapeCls, className),\n    style: _extends(_extends({}, sizeStyle), style)\n  });\n};\n\nexport default Element;"]},"metadata":{},"sourceType":"module"}